The P5G Gladius is a light fighter produced by Aegis. Its first design was introduced in 2579 as a replacement for the StarCitizen:Stiletto and has been updated over the years to keep up with modern technology.<ref>Script error: No such module "Cite RSI".</ref> In military circles, the Gladius is beloved for its performance and its simplicity. A fast, light fighter with a laser-focus on dogfighting, the Gladius is an ideal interceptor or escort ship.<ref>Script error: No such module "Cite RSI".</ref>

Lore

<tabber>

Development=

The Gladius was developed in the 26th century by StarCitizen:Aegis Dynamics to replace the Stiletto interceptors. It was first deployed in the StarCitizen:First Tevarin War.<ref>Jump Point September 2014</ref><ref>Script error: No such module "Cite RSI".</ref> |-|

Declassification=

In StarCitizen:2944, with some Gladius squadrons converting to the wider deployment of the StarCitizen:F7A Hornet and the introduction of the StarCitizen:F8 Lightning to elite units, the Navy has begun to auction older Gladius to planetary governments and qualified mercenaries. The spacecraft available to civilians are retired military models, with the same specifications and upgrade potential. Classified weapons technologies have been removed from the spaceframes, but they can be outfitted with a variety of civilian-grade weapons. The decommissioning process has also made room for StarCitizen:civilian standard upgrades such as jump drives.<ref>Script error: No such module "Cite RSI".</ref> </tabber>

Development

<templatestyles src="Template:Timeline styles/styles.css" />

2014-11-03 The Gladius was designed by StarCitizen:Gavin Rothery (Freelance Conceptist)<ref>Gavin Rothery: Star Citizen Hardware and Ship Design</ref> and directed by StarCitizen:Paul Jones. Other contributors include StarCitizen:Foundry 42's StarCitizen:Bjorn Seinstra (Lead Vehicle Artist), StarCitizen:Phill Meller (Lead Designer), StarCitizen:Neil McKnight (Senior 3D Artist), along with StarCitizen:Chris Roberts.<ref>Script error: No such module "Cite RSI".</ref>
2017-07-09 The Gladius received a cockpit rework to accompany the new StarCitizen:item 2.0 system. The center monitor is removed to provide better visibility for the front turret. The side monitors are enlarged to show additional information. The cockpit reworked is deployed in StarCitizen:Star Citizen Alpha 3.0.0.<ref>Script error: No such module "Cite RSI".</ref>
2021-04-01 The gold standard Gladius is released to the StarCitizen:Persistent Universe in Alpha 3.13.0. That includes many level of detail, decal, geometry, material, and paint changes inside the cockpit and on the exterior of the ship. Noticeably, the update implements the exterior access points to the physicalized components, as well as personal locker, fuel port access, and numerous maintenance panels.<ref>Script error: No such module "Cite RSI".</ref><ref name="ingame3130">In-game survey.Template:NbspAlpha 3.13.0 -Template:NbspStar Citizen<templatestyles src="Module:Cite/styles.css"/></ref>
